Contents
Index
uu-cco-0.1.0.5: Utilities for compiler construction: core functionality
Index
<!>
CCO.Parsing
>#<
CCO.Printing
>-<
CCO.Printing
>//<
CCO.Printing
>^<
CCO.Printing
>|<
CCO.Printing
above
CCO.Printing
alpha
CCO.Lexing
alphaNum
CCO.Lexing
angles
CCO.Printing
Ann
CCO.Tree
anyChar
CCO.Lexing
anyCharBut
CCO.Lexing
anyCharFrom
CCO.Lexing
App
CCO.Tree
app
CCO.Tree.Parser
arg
CCO.Tree.Parser
ArgumentParser
CCO.Tree.Parser
ATerm
CCO.Tree
besides
CCO.Printing
binDigit
CCO.Lexing
binDigit_
CCO.Lexing
black
CCO.Printing
blue
CCO.Printing
braces
CCO.Printing
brackets
CCO.Printing
chainl
CCO.Parsing
chainr
CCO.Parsing
char
CCO.Lexing
choice
CCO.Parsing
choose
CCO.Printing
colon
CCO.Printing
comma
CCO.Printing
Component
CCO.Component
component
CCO.Component
Con
CCO.Tree
cyan
CCO.Printing
describe
CCO.Parsing
digit
CCO.Lexing
digit_
CCO.Lexing
Doc
CCO.Printing
empty
CCO.Printing
enclose
CCO.Printing
EOF
CCO.SourcePos
eof
CCO.Parsing
Error
1 (Data Constructor)
CCO.Feedback
2 (Data Constructor)
CCO.Lexing
errorMessage
CCO.Feedback
failing
CCO.Feedback
Feedback
CCO.Feedback
File
CCO.SourcePos
Float
CCO.Tree
float
CCO.Tree.Parser
fromMessage
CCO.Feedback
fromTree
CCO.Tree
green
CCO.Printing
hexDigit
CCO.Lexing
hexDigit_
CCO.Lexing
ignore
CCO.Lexing
indent
CCO.Printing
Integer
CCO.Tree
integer
CCO.Tree.Parser
ioRun
CCO.Component
ioWrap
CCO.Component
isEmpty
CCO.Printing
isError
CCO.Feedback
join
CCO.Printing
langle
CCO.Printing
lbrace
CCO.Printing
lbracket
CCO.Printing
letter
CCO.Lexing
lex
CCO.Lexing
lexeme
CCO.Parsing
Lexer
CCO.Lexing
LexicalUnit
CCO.Lexing
List
CCO.Tree
list
CCO.Tree.Parser
Log
CCO.Feedback
lower
CCO.Lexing
lparen
CCO.Printing
magenta
CCO.Printing
manySepBy
CCO.Parsing
Message
CCO.Feedback
message
1 (Function)
CCO.Feedback
2 (Function)
CCO.Lexing
messages
CCO.Feedback
Msg
CCO.Lexing
notInRange
CCO.Lexing
octDigit
CCO.Lexing
octDigit_
CCO.Lexing
opt
CCO.Parsing
parens
CCO.Printing
parse
CCO.Parsing
Parser
CCO.Parsing
parser
1 (Function)
CCO.Component
2 (Function)
CCO.Tree
parseTree
CCO.Tree.Parser
parse_
CCO.Parsing
period
CCO.Printing
Pos
1 (Type/Class)
CCO.SourcePos
2 (Data Constructor)
CCO.SourcePos
pp
CCO.Printing
Printable
CCO.Printing
printer
CCO.Component
range
CCO.Lexing
rangle
CCO.Printing
rbrace
CCO.Printing
rbracket
CCO.Printing
red
CCO.Printing
render
CCO.Printing
renderHeight
CCO.Printing
renderHeight_
CCO.Printing
renderIO
CCO.Printing
renderIOHeight
CCO.Printing
renderIOHeight_
CCO.Printing
renderIO_
CCO.Printing
render_
CCO.Printing
rparen
CCO.Printing
runFeedback
CCO.Feedback
satisfy
1 (Function)
CCO.Lexing
2 (Function)
CCO.Parsing
semicolon
CCO.Printing
sepBy
CCO.Printing
showable
CCO.Printing
someSepBy
CCO.Parsing
Source
CCO.SourcePos
SourcePos
1 (Type/Class)
CCO.SourcePos
2 (Data Constructor)
CCO.SourcePos
sourcePos
CCO.Parsing
space
1 (Function)
CCO.Printing
2 (Function)
CCO.Lexing
split
CCO.Printing
Stdin
CCO.SourcePos
String
CCO.Tree
string
1 (Function)
CCO.Tree.Parser
2 (Function)
CCO.Lexing
succeeding
CCO.Feedback
Symbol
CCO.Parsing
Symbols
1 (Type/Class)
CCO.Lexing
2 (Data Constructor)
CCO.Lexing
text
CCO.Printing
Token
CCO.Lexing
tokens
CCO.Lexing
tokens_
CCO.Lexing
toTree
CCO.Tree
trace
CCO.Feedback
trace_
CCO.Feedback
Tree
CCO.Tree
TreeParser
CCO.Tree.Parser
Tuple
CCO.Tree
tuple
CCO.Tree.Parser
upper
CCO.Lexing
warn
CCO.Feedback
Warning
CCO.Feedback
warn_
CCO.Feedback
wError
CCO.Feedback
white
CCO.Printing
wrapped
CCO.Printing
yellow
CCO.Printing